Regional Councils of Governments

24 Service Areas ( Governor’s State Planning Regions, Chapter 391, Texas Local Government Code)

1 2 3 22 7 4 18 23 11 24 8 10 9 5 12 13 16 17 21 20 19 6 15 14

  • 1. Panhandle Regional Planning Commission
  • 2. South Plains Association of Governments
  • 3. Nortex Regional Planning Commission
  • 4. North Central Texas Council of Governments
  • 5. Ark-Tex Council of Governments
  • 6. East Texas Council of Governments
  • 7. West Central Texas Council of Governments
  • 8. Rio Grande Council of Governments
  • 9. Permian Basin Council of Governments
  • 10. Concho Valley Council of Governments
  • 11. Heart of Texas Council of Governments
  • 12. Capital Area Council of Governments
  • 13. Brazos Valley Council of Governments
  • 14. Deep East Texas Council of Governments
  • 15. South East Texas Regional Planning Commission
  • 16. Houston-Galveston Area Council
  • 17. Golden Crescent Regional Planning Commission
  • 18. Alamo Area Council of Governments
  • 19. South Texas Development Council
  • 20. Coastal Bend Council of Governments
  • 21. Lower Rio Grande Valley Development Council
  • 22. Texoma Council of Governments
  • 23. Central Texas Council of Governments
  • 24. Middle Rio Grande Development Council

UHF Channel Names

P25 CAI Analog FCC 30-512 MHz Public Safety Bands Recommendation NCC Channel Label Radio Service Base / Mobile Frequency (MHz)

  • r Channel Set

UTAC3 UTAC3A 4TAC30 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 458.8625 UTAC2 UTAC2A 4TAC29 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 458.7125 UTAC1 UTAC1A 4TAC28 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 458.4625 UCALL UCALLA 4CAL27D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 458.2125 UTAC3D UTAC3AD 4TAC30D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 453.8625 UTAC2D UTAC2AD 4TAC29D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 453.7125 UTAC1D UTAC1AD 4TAC28D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 453.4625 UCALLD UCALLAD 4CAL27D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 453.2125

800 MHz Channel Names

8TAC4D 8TAC4AD 8TAC94D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 868.0125 8TAC3D 8TAC3AD 8TAC93D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 867.5125 8TAC2D 8TAC2AD 8TAC92D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 867.0125 8TAC1D 8TAC1AD 8TAC91D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 866.5125 8CALLD 8CALLAD 8CAL90D Any Public Safety Eligible Base / Mobile 866.0125 8TAC4 8TAC4A 8TAC94 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 823.0125 8TAC3 8TAC3A 8TAC93 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 822.5125 8TAC2 8TAC2A 8TAC92 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 822.0125 8TAC1 8TAC1A 8TAC91 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 821.5125 8CALL 8CALLA 8CAL90 Any Public Safety Eligible Mobile 821.0125
